UNG Watch

The natural-gas exchange-traded fund, UNG, is showing a bear flag on Person's Proprietary Signal with a fairly stunning 7.5% decline high to low in intra-day trading.

I would want to see a pullback and bounce before going to short on this. The move was based on today's natural gas inventory report, which showed high inventories.

Capitalism 101: High support relative to demand = lower prices.

The downside target on Persons' Pivots is $5.60.
